Hotel Description

Travelodge Edinburgh Park is a relaxed hotel ideally situated at 53 S Gyle Broadway, Edinburgh EH12 9LR, United Kingdom. This property boasts a convenient location along a main road, making it perfect for both business and leisure travelers. It is just a 7-minute walk from South Gyle train station, ensuring quick access to the heart of Edinburgh and surrounding attractions. The hotel is also only 3 miles from Edinburgh Zoo and 7 miles from the iconic Edinburgh Castle, two must-see attractions that make the hotel’s location even more appealing. The hotel's design embraces a comfortable, no-frills approach, offering guests a warm and welcoming atmosphere with a focus on simplicity and convenience.
The rooms at Travelodge Edinburgh Park are designed for maximum comfort and practicality. All rooms feature modern amenities including Wi-Fi, flat-screen TVs, and tea and coffee-making facilities to ensure a pleasant stay. Some rooms offer bathtubs, while others are equipped with showers, catering to various guest preferences. Families will find ample space in the family rooms, which can accommodate up to four guests.
Guests will enjoy a variety of amenities that enhance their stay, including air conditioning, ensuring a cool and comfortable environment, especially during the warmer months. For guests who prefer dining in, there is a lively café and bar on-site, providing a great spot to relax and unwind. The hotel also offers parking, smoke-free rooms, and a breakfast buffet to start the day off right.
In terms of accessibility, the hotel is well-served by public transport. South Gyle station is just a short walk away, offering easy connections to Edinburgh and beyond. Edinburgh Airport is approximately a 16-minute drive, making the hotel an ideal choice for travelers with early flights or those seeking convenience when heading to and from the airport.
Travelodge Edinburgh Park prioritizes guest safety with a number of health and safety measures in place. These include a smoke-free environment, accessible rooms, and a front desk available for any assistance or emergency.
